In recent days, Botafogo’s Football Corporation (SAF) filed for judicial recovery. Asked about the matter at an event this Thursday (23), Flamengo president Luiz Eduardo Baptista, known as Bap, blasted the move made by the rival club.
— I understand that the SAF model in Brazil needs to be revised. In this specific case (Botafogo), when this SAF was created, the debt was around 700 million reais, if I’m not mistaken. Today, from what we read, the debt is three and a half times that amount. And then you ask for judicial recovery, which includes the first part of the debt that, in theory, you came in as the solution to cover. You didn’t cover the old debt and added another 1 billion and change in debt, and now you have a single restructuring package —, Bap began.
— We have to learn from this. SAF is an important mechanism, but it must have limits and obligations. You can’t simply give credit to someone who says they will invest money in the club, fulfills nothing, and gets away with it. There are cases that are doing well, like Red Bull and Bahia, which honor their commitments. This example (Botafogo) is not what should represent the majority. But we have to understand that money that comes in to help and meet commitments is welcome; what doesn’t do that must be punished severely. We cannot create mechanisms that allow this kind of situation —, added the Flamengo president during the Brazilian Club Committee event.
Botafogo is going through a dramatic financial situation, with debt totaling R$ 2.753 billion. Of this amount, R$ 1.643 billion is short-term debt (that is: to be paid within 12 months). Therefore, judicial recovery is a way to organize a “pool” of civil and labor debts while the company (in this case, the SAF) remains protected from enforcement actions (asset seizures) or freezes stemming from those same debts
“SAF Botafogo filed, this Wednesday (22), with the Rio de Janeiro Court of Justice (TJ-RJ), a request for Judicial Recovery, as a strategic move for financial reorganization and course correction for the continuity and strengthening of the sports project launched in 2022. As part of the request, the SAF also asked for the temporary suspension of the voting rights of the majority shareholder, who for several months has used that position to block the arrival of new capital into the football club,” the club said on Wednesday (22).
As an invited guest, Luiz Eduardo Baptista took part in the Brazilian Club Committee and gave a speech against the taxation of non-profit associations in comparison precisely to Football Corporations. In short, Flamengo is one of the leaders of this movement, as it believes SAFs have an advantage when it comes to how these amounts are charged.
